Curve 14400dc2

14400 = 26 · 32 · 52



Data for elliptic curve 14400dc2

Field Data Notes
Atkin-Lehner 2- 3+ 5- Signs for the Atkin-Lehner involutions
Class 14400dc Isogeny class
Conductor 14400 Conductor
∏ cp 16 Product of Tamagawa factors cp
Δ -157464000000000 = -1 · 212 · 39 · 59 Discriminant
Eigenvalues 2- 3+ 5-  0  0  4 -2  0 Hecke eigenvalues for primes up to 20
Equation [0,0,0,13500,0] [a1,a2,a3,a4,a6]
Generators [486:11016:1] Generators of the group modulo torsion
j 1728 j-invariant
L 4.9757006194887 L(r)(E,1)/r!
Ω 0.34401214562069 Real period
R 3.6159338288123 Regulator
r 1 Rank of the group of rational points
S 1 (Analytic) order of Ш
t 2 Number of elements in the torsion subgroup
Twists 14400dc2 7200be1 14400db2 14400dd2 Quadratic twists by: -4 8 -3 5
